Dulukala Peranakan Restaurant

One of the best Peranakan restaurant in Singapore!

The four of us went to Dulukala Peranakan Restaurant tonight after reading so many good reviews. We ordered 5 items and 1 dessert.

1. Assam Fishhead - 9/10 - Sour and little sweet. Though it is not spicy enough, I simply love it.


2. Rendang Beef - 8/10 - Meat is tender and overall flavour is very good.


3. Ayam Buah Keluak - 7/10 - Sour but not spicy and the meat is not tender enough.


4. Omelette Chichalok - 8/10 - Taste like Furong omelette but is definitely better than many others. I like it thick so that it will not be crispy.


5. Chye Sin - 7/10 - This is a replacement of sambal sweet potato leaves as the latter runs out..


6. Chendol - 7/10 - The green chendol is soft and seems to be handmade rather than factory made. The gula melaka flavour is quite strong. However, it would be even bettter if the coconut milk is those freshly squeezed type (just like the penang famous chendol).


We are very satisfied with the food and will defintely come back here again to try their other dishes such as sambal sotong, curry chicken, etc..
